marsh spurge vs Namdapha Flying Squirrel
Euphorbia palustris compared with Biswamoyopterus biswasi
Key Differences
- marsh spurge is Least Concern while Namdapha Flying Squirrel is Critically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| marsh spurge | Namdapha Flying Squirrel |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Malpighiales (Malpighiales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Euphorbiaceae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Euphorbia | Biswamoyopterus |
| Species | Euphorbia palustris | Biswamoyopterus biswasi |
